{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":742491899,"defaultBranch":"main","name":"config.ml","ownerLogin":"ocaml-sys","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-01-12T15:46:26.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/158750813?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1713958254.0","currentOid":""},"activityList":{"items":[{"before":"1cbc2d439d86969cf15771e45b7fbd9866bae129","after":"f850715406b2ea28bbbed76826f0b97c4f933857","ref":"refs/heads/main","pushedAt":"2024-04-30T08:35:02.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"ci: Install ocamlformat in GHA for fmt command. (#21)","shortMessageHtmlLink":"ci: Install ocamlformat in GHA for fmt command. (#21)"}},{"before":"05a4fb45b56c1ca2ce8a5b3d77aef8a27b53ced2","after":"1cbc2d439d86969cf15771e45b7fbd9866bae129","ref":"refs/heads/main","pushedAt":"2024-04-24T11:30:34.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"chore: prepare release","shortMessageHtmlLink":"chore: prepare release"}},{"before":"cb8d3483c87ba5666c34883346ed3903b4cfaff7","after":"05a4fb45b56c1ca2ce8a5b3d77aef8a27b53ced2","ref":"refs/heads/main","pushedAt":"2024-04-24T11:27:26.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"docs: update Cookbook examples (#19)\n\n* Update readme cookbook with new examples.","shortMessageHtmlLink":"docs: update Cookbook examples (#19)"}},{"before":"c9a92a1cffd4d1661ef5514fe5b8c58ad8b0b121","after":"cb8d3483c87ba5666c34883346ed3903b4cfaff7","ref":"refs/heads/main","pushedAt":"2024-04-24T11:25: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"ci: check formatting on PRs","shortMessageHtmlLink":"ci: check formatting on PRs"}},{"before":"025410661f773582c1873bf25e3a83b1a86ddddd","after":"c9a92a1cffd4d1661ef5514fe5b8c58ad8b0b121","ref":"refs/heads/main","pushedAt":"2024-04-24T11:20:21.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: apply @config on module structs and signatures (#18)\n\n* Feature: Apply config on module structs and signatures\r\n\r\n* Add test case for module interface files.\r\n\r\n* Updated test.\r\n\r\n* Format code","shortMessageHtmlLink":"feat: apply @config on module structs and signatures (#18)"}},{"before":"d248987cc1795de99d3735c06635dbd355d4d642","after":"025410661f773582c1873bf25e3a83b1a86ddddd","ref":"refs/heads/main","pushedAt":"2024-04-11T01:55:54.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: support cases and function branches (#13)\n\n* Feature: Add case match annotation\r\n* Fix test.\r\n* PR edits\r\n* Format files.","shortMessageHtmlLink":"feat: support cases and function branches (#13)"}},{"before":"56913b944f1337dd0d03215ef6ff3e4380429829","after":"d248987cc1795de99d3735c06635dbd355d4d642","ref":"refs/heads/main","pushedAt":"2024-03-16T12:46:45.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"tests: add more not expression tests (#12)","shortMessageHtmlLink":"tests: add more not expression tests (#12)"}},{"before":"4c7b75baa7b18478f604a94d71d6f91b2bf19d4f","after":"56913b944f1337dd0d03215ef6ff3e4380429829","ref":"refs/heads/main","pushedAt":"2024-03-16T12:45:31.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"chore(nix): use same version of nixpkgs everywhere (#16)","shortMessageHtmlLink":"chore(nix): use same version of nixpkgs everywhere (#16)"}},{"before":"164d23b8a72373536c652c629bf3a6c835fa8edb","after":"4c7b75baa7b18478f604a94d71d6f91b2bf19d4f","ref":"refs/heads/main","pushedAt":"2024-03-09T11:19:03.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"chore(nix): add nix flake (#14)","shortMessageHtmlLink":"chore(nix): add nix flake (#14)"}},{"before":"f0f7ca50577a9a977e11bac7756d223868623dca","after":"164d23b8a72373536c652c629bf3a6c835fa8edb","ref":"refs/heads/main","pushedAt":"2024-03-09T11:18:08.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"fix(tests): explicit env for macos and ubuntu. (#15)","shortMessageHtmlLink":"fix(tests): explicit env for macos and ubuntu. (#15)"}},{"before":"8225ccd37d5260ec00d7a1f269b08174d3cec292","after":"f0f7ca50577a9a977e11bac7756d223868623dca","ref":"refs/heads/main","pushedAt":"2024-03-04T21:13:45.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"refactor: use parsetree as eval input (#11)\n\n* Inspect the expression instead of parsing its representation\r\n\r\n* Tidy up eval_attr by extracting the expression\r\n\r\n* Inspect the expression instead of parsing its representation\r\n\r\n* Remove sedlex dependency\r\n\r\n* Use more metaquot\r\n\r\n---------\r\n\r\nCo-authored-by: Leandro Ostera ","shortMessageHtmlLink":"refactor: use parsetree as eval input (#11)"}},{"before":"fcf368e52ccf40b1c1b209d93063b41e3621f478","after":"8225ccd37d5260ec00d7a1f269b08174d3cec292","ref":"refs/heads/main","pushedAt":"2024-03-04T21:05:58.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"chore: tidy up eval_attr by extracting the expression (#10)\n\n* Tidy up eval_attr by extracting the expression\r\n\r\n* fix: keep commented print for debugging\r\n\r\n---------\r\n\r\nCo-authored-by: Leandro Ostera ","shortMessageHtmlLink":"chore: tidy up eval_attr by extracting the expression (#10)"}},{"before":"77fc0f7f7b50a279664e4e77cd83e4637c225a90","after":"fcf368e52ccf40b1c1b209d93063b41e3621f478","ref":"refs/heads/main","pushedAt":"2024-03-04T21:04:03.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"test: add test and documentation for short tag @cfg (#8)\n\nCo-authored-by: Kevin Fox ","shortMessageHtmlLink":"test: add test and documentation for short tag @cfg (#8)"}},{"before":"470b031c7a96abe25a0c98cbf840db25727193a6","after":"77fc0f7f7b50a279664e4e77cd83e4637c225a90","ref":"refs/heads/main","pushedAt":"2024-03-04T21:03:24.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"chore: remove unused 'bug' function (#6)\n\nCo-authored-by: Kevin Fox ","shortMessageHtmlLink":"chore: remove unused 'bug' function (#6)"}},{"before":"eb034d52fb1d55bdf2bae0ed02d69d676929bf33","after":"470b031c7a96abe25a0c98cbf840db25727193a6","ref":"refs/heads/main","pushedAt":"2024-02-27T22:58:51.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"fix: drop e2e libc test","shortMessageHtmlLink":"fix: drop e2e libc test"}},{"before":"1919a394f31ab67c887267adf5f0344a7222c058","after":"eb034d52fb1d55bdf2bae0ed02d69d676929bf33","ref":"refs/heads/main","pushedAt":"2024-02-27T22:47:05.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: support short cfg alias in melange","shortMessageHtmlLink":"feat: support short cfg alias in melange"}},{"before":"5b07a5f2ecbfaa53459d80c87cfe08d7e76c8f6e","after":"1919a394f31ab67c887267adf5f0344a7222c058","ref":"refs/heads/main","pushedAt":"2024-02-27T21:36:05.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: support polymorphic variants","shortMessageHtmlLink":"feat: support polymorphic variants"}},{"before":"105d1e3504f91962ef7340d0fe4f81c960daa963","after":"5b07a5f2ecbfaa53459d80c87cfe08d7e76c8f6e","ref":"refs/heads/main","pushedAt":"2024-02-27T21:34: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: support polymorphic variants","shortMessageHtmlLink":"feat: support polymorphic variants"}},{"before":"cae2b51d44f3dd3341585b45fbf7b9990fc6c6f3","after":"105d1e3504f91962ef7340d0fe4f81c960daa963","ref":"refs/heads/main","pushedAt":"2024-02-27T20:23:33.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"docs: prepare 0.0.2 release","shortMessageHtmlLink":"docs: prepare 0.0.2 release"}},{"before":"109cbeed927eba32d01d9e857588d273b7204757","after":"cae2b51d44f3dd3341585b45fbf7b9990fc6c6f3","ref":"refs/heads/main","pushedAt":"2024-02-27T20:21:58.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"docs: prepare 0.0.2 release","shortMessageHtmlLink":"docs: prepare 0.0.2 release"}},{"before":"6b20af73a8ee72a5ef58846053824cfe81449056","after":"109cbeed927eba32d01d9e857588d273b7204757","ref":"refs/heads/main","pushedAt":"2024-02-27T20:11: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"docs: add entire module disables to the cookbook","shortMessageHtmlLink":"docs: add entire module disables to the cookbook"}},{"before":"f87e5f0ca694d1ac7c6a5d331e143ec2937f2712","after":"6b20af73a8ee72a5ef58846053824cfe81449056","ref":"refs/heads/main","pushedAt":"2024-02-27T20:04:28.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: support conditional constructors and fields","shortMessageHtmlLink":"feat: support conditional constructors and fields"}},{"before":"1d3614582d5f1d4452dff2a8b7f772baf9b6dad4","after":"f87e5f0ca694d1ac7c6a5d331e143ec2937f2712","ref":"refs/heads/main","pushedAt":"2024-02-26T21:57:42.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: add big e2e skip test","shortMessageHtmlLink":"feat: add big e2e skip test"}},{"before":"40c25482b15380509d37eccc3ba80049c526f127","after":"1d3614582d5f1d4452dff2a8b7f772baf9b6dad4","ref":"refs/heads/main","pushedAt":"2024-02-26T21:54: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: add big e2e skip test","shortMessageHtmlLink":"feat: add big e2e skip test"}},{"before":"9de54676e2f637adee7df63d0b224264ef5f81f8","after":"40c25482b15380509d37eccc3ba80049c526f127","ref":"refs/heads/main","pushedAt":"2024-02-26T21:35:50.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: support all top-level structure items","shortMessageHtmlLink":"feat: support all top-level structure items"}},{"before":"a5688536cfd88bddf8f1265cd660564497d7de9a","after":"9de54676e2f637adee7df63d0b224264ef5f81f8","ref":"refs/heads/main","pushedAt":"2024-02-26T21:35:16.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"feat: support all top-level structure items","shortMessageHtmlLink":"feat: support all top-level structure items"}},{"before":"65cbaacc340be3935a981bc38a33ca14371c7a14","after":"a5688536cfd88bddf8f1265cd660564497d7de9a","ref":"refs/heads/main","pushedAt":"2024-02-26T16:04:43.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"fix: single var config failing (#1)","shortMessageHtmlLink":"fix: single var config failing (#1)"}},{"before":"d7b1513186ecc8d411a66e0f782d3c534f6be45e","after":"65cbaacc340be3935a981bc38a33ca14371c7a14","ref":"refs/heads/main","pushedAt":"2024-02-07T14:24:31.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"docs: update changes","shortMessageHtmlLink":"docs: update changes"}},{"before":"a3fb97adf9d8a64a24c7b54358641e014573ee88","after":"d7b1513186ecc8d411a66e0f782d3c534f6be45e","ref":"refs/heads/main","pushedAt":"2024-01-16T12:28:16.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"test: update expected results","shortMessageHtmlLink":"test: update expected results"}},{"before":"fd4c8575761293ed8d179db769e61d2cae98a457","after":"a3fb97adf9d8a64a24c7b54358641e014573ee88","ref":"refs/heads/main","pushedAt":"2024-01-16T12:26:31.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"leostera","name":"Leandro Ostera","path":"/leostera","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/854222?s=80&v=4"},"commit":{"message":"docs: update changes","shortMessageHtmlLink":"docs: update changes"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EPcYdWgA","startCursor":null,"endCursor":null}},"title":"Activity ยท ocaml-sys/config.ml"}